Final 5K Nest Challenge Results

By Joe Elliott, National Marketing Director
What an exciting finish to the PFA 5K Nest Challenge! Congratulations to Nest 128, Duryea, Pa., on its first place finish with a strong sprint at the end. The contest proved to be a spirited one with Nests jockeying back and forth in their positions and making the finish line a very busy place.

As you may remember, the 5K Nest Challenge was a 13-month membership campaign where Nests earned points for life insurance certificates issued with face amounts in multiples of $5,000. Also eligible were annuity and IRA certificates established at a minimum of $5,000 with points for subsequent levels of $5,000. The 5K also referred to the first-place prize of $5,000 that would be awarded to the winning Nest qualifying with a minimum of 30 points.

Cash prizes were also awarded to the next five highest finishing Nests. Those Nests in order of finish were
Nest 176, Pittsburgh, Pa. –– 2nd
Nest 564, La Porte, Ind. –– 3rd
Nest 163, Mocanaqua, Pa. –– 4th
Nest 519, Middletown, Conn. –– 5th
Nest 4, South Bend, Ind. –– 6th.
